What is Augmented Reality?
Augmented Reality is a technology that enhances the real-world environment with computer-generated sensory input such as sound, video, graphics, and GPS data. It allows users to interact with the real world in a more intuitive and immersive way.
Augmented Reality for Engineering
In the engineering industry, Augmented Reality has several use cases that are already transforming the way engineering processes are carried out. Here are a few examples:
- Visualization of Complex Designs: AR can be used to visualize complex engineering designs in 3D, making it easier for engineers to understand the structure and layout of a building, machine or product. AR can also help engineers to identify any potential design flaws before the construction process begins.
- Simulation of Construction Processes: AR can simulate construction processes, making it easier to detect any issues or risks that could arise during the construction process. AR can also help engineers to monitor the progress of construction and ensure that everything is going according to plan.
- Streamlining Workflows: AR can be used to streamline engineering workflows by providing engineers with real-time information and data. For example, AR can provide engineers with a real-time view of the status of a machine or equipment, making it easier to identify any issues and take corrective action.
- Training: AR can also be used for training purposes, allowing engineers to practice and learn new skills in a safe and controlled environment.
Benefits of Augmented Reality for Engineering
The use of Augmented Reality in engineering processes can bring several benefits, including:
- Increased efficiency and productivity: AR can streamline workflows, reducing the time it takes to complete engineering processes and increasing productivity.
- Improved accuracy: AR can help engineers to identify and correct design flaws, reducing the risk of errors during the construction process.
- Enhanced collaboration: AR can enable engineers to collaborate more effectively, improving communication and reducing the risk of miscommunication.
- Cost savings: By detecting and addressing issues early in the engineering process, AR can help to reduce costs associated with construction, maintenance, and repairs.
